Abstract
This paper describes the design and implementation of a 2.4-GHz fully-differential logarithmic amplifier for RF signal power detection. A novel self-bias wideband amplifier without on-chip inductor is employed as a limiting amplifier stage. The proposed logarithmic amplifier is realized and fabricated in a 0.35-μm CMOS technology. Measurement results showed that the circuit achieved 43-dB voltage gain, while drawing 73.5 mA from a single 2.5-V power supply voltage. © 2008 IEEE.
